What Is The Difference Between Ginger Beer And Jamaican Ginger Beer?

Ginger beer and Jamaican ginger beer are two popular beverages that are often confused due to their similar names. While both drinks share the common ingredient of ginger, there are some significant differences that set them apart. In this article, we will delve into the unique characteristics of each beverage and explore why Jamaican ginger beer offers a distinct experience for ginger lovers.

The Flavors of Ginger Beer

Ginger beer is a non-alcoholic beverage that is made by fermenting ginger, sugar, and water. It is renowned for its spicy and tangy flavor profile, offering a refreshing and invigorating taste. This effervescent drink is a favorite among those who enjoy a zesty kick in their beverages.

The Intensity of Jamaican Ginger Beer

When it comes to Jamaican ginger beer, the flavor takes on a whole new level of intensity. Traditional Jamaican ginger, known for its potency, imparts a unique and fiery taste to the beverage. The ginger used in Jamaican ginger beer is stronger and spicier than varieties found in other countries, giving this particular ginger beer an exceptionally bold and robust flavor.

The Ingredients in Jamaican Ginger Beer

Aside from the difference in ginger intensity, the ingredients in Jamaican ginger beer closely resemble those found in regular ginger beer. Fresh ginger, sugar, water, and sometimes lime juice are combined to create an aromatic and flavorful base. However, the key distinction lies in the type of ginger used in Jamaican ginger beer, which sets it apart from its counterparts.

Jamaican Ginger: An Authentic Twist

Jamaican ginger, also known as Yellow ginger or Jamaican yellow ginger, is renowned for its exceptional quality. It is widely recognized as one of the finest gingers in the world. This variety boasts a potent flavor due to its higher content of gingerol, the active compound responsible for the spice and heat found in ginger.

Versatility in Cocktails

While ginger beer is primarily enjoyed on its own, both variations can be utilized as key ingredients in cocktails. Jamaican ginger beer, with its bold flavor, can add an extra kick to classic cocktails like Moscow Mule or Dark and Stormy. It elevates the overall experience, adding complexity and depth to the drink.
